Biomass plant given go-ahead

A massive biomass energy plant in Port Talbot has been given the go ahead. After months of consultation, the Environment Agency has granted Prenergy Power the licence to operate.

However the power station which will burn up to 3m tonnes of wood each year is still opposed by some campaigners. Nicola Smith reports.
